This is a seldom seen example of the rare "Straight Bladed" Tulwar war sword. Dating from the late 18th or early 19th century mostly, these have a very characteristic round nosed blade becoming broader at the front. Even though there is no curve, the 28 inch long blade still has a clear front and back edge.
